lines changed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change 1+ # Xcode
2+ #
3+ # gitignore contributors: remember to update Global/Xcode.gitignore, Objective-C.gitignore & Swift.gitignore
4+
5+ # # User settings
6+ xcuserdata /
7+
8+ # # compatibility with Xcode 8 and earlier (ignoring not required starting Xcode 9)
9+ * .xcscmblueprint
10+ * .xccheckout
11+
12+ # # compatibility with Xcode 3 and earlier (ignoring not required starting Xcode 4)
13+ build /
14+ DerivedData /
15+ * .moved-aside
16+ * .pbxuser
17+ ! default.pbxuser
18+ * .mode1v3
19+ ! default.mode1v3
20+ * .mode2v3
21+ ! default.mode2v3
22+ * .perspectivev3
23+ ! default.perspectivev3
24+
25+ # # Obj-C/Swift specific
26+ * .hmap
27+
28+ # # App packaging
29+ * .ipa
30+ * .dSYM.zip
31+ * .dSYM
32+
33+ # # Playgrounds
34+ timeline.xctimeline
35+ playground.xcworkspace
36+
37+ # Swift Package Manager
38+ #
39+ # Add this line if you want to avoid checking in source code from Swift Package Manager dependencies.
40+ # Packages/
41+ # Package.pins
42+ # Package.resolved
43+ # *.xcodeproj
44+ #
45+ # Xcode automatically generates this directory with a .xcworkspacedata file and xcuserdata
46+ # hence it is not needed unless you have added a package configuration file to your project
47+ # .swiftpm
48+
49+ .build /
50+ .fleet /
51+
52+ # CocoaPods
53+ #
54+ # We recommend against adding the Pods directory to your .gitignore. However
55+ # you should judge for yourself, the pros and cons are mentioned at:
56+ # https://guides.cocoapods.org/using/using-cocoapods.html#should-i-check-the-pods-directory-into-source-control
57+
58+ Pods /
59+
60+ # intellij idea
61+ .idea /*
62+
63+ .DS_Store
